%bcond_without libalternatives
%{?sle15_python_module_pythons}
Name: python-ruff
Version: 0.1.11
Release: 0
Summary: An extremely fast Python linter, written in Rust
License: MIT
URL: https://docs.astral.sh/ruff
Source: https://files.pythonhosted.org/packages/source/r/ruff/ruff-%{version}.tar.gz
Source1: vendor.tar.zst
BuildRequires: %{python_module maturin}
BuildRequires: %{python_module pip}
BuildRequires: cargo-packaging
BuildRequires: fdupes
BuildRequires: python-rpm-macros
Requires: alts
BuildRequires: alts
ExclusiveArch: %{rust_tier1_arches}
%python_subpackages
%description
Ruff extremely fast Python linter written in rust supperseding many other linting tools
%prep
%autosetup -a1 -p1 -n ruff-%{version}
%build
%pyproject_wheel
%install
%pyproject_install
%python_expand %fdupes %{buildroot}%{$python_sitearch}
%python_clone -a %{buildroot}%{_bindir}/ruff
%python_group_libalternatives ruff
%pre
%python_libalternatives_reset_alternative ruff
%files %{python_files}
%python_alternative %{_bindir}/ruff
%{python_sitearch}/ruff
%{python_sitearch}/ruff-%{version}.dist-info
%changelog
